  • Purpose: This study evaluated the validity and reliability of Shively and colleagues' self-efficacy for HIV disease management skills (HIV-SE) among Korean participants. Methods: The original HIV-SE questionnaire, comprising 34 items, was translated into Korean using a translation and back-translation process. To enhance clarity and eliminate redundancy, the author and expert committee engaged in multiple discussions and integrated two items with similar meanings into a single item. Further, four HIV nurse experts tested content validity. Survey data were collected from 227 individuals diagnosed with HIV from five Korean hospitals. Construct validity was verified through confirmatory factor analysis. Criterion validity was evaluated using Pearson's correlation coefficients with the new general self-efficacy scale. Internal consistency reliability and test-retest were examined for reliability. Results: The Korean version of HIV-SE (K-HIV-SE) comprises 33 items across six domains: "managing depression/mood," "managing medications," "managing symptoms," "communicating with a healthcare provider," "getting support/help," and "managing fatigue." The fitness of the modified model was acceptable (minimum value of the discrepancy function/degree of freedom = 2.49, root mean square error of approximation = .08, goodness-of-fit index = .76, adjusted goodness-of-fit index = .71, Tucker-Lewis index = .84, and comparative fit index = .86). The internal consistency reliability (Cronbach's α = .91) and test-retest reliability (intraclass correlation coefficient = .73) were good. The criterion validity of the K-HIV-SE was .59 (p < .001). Conclusion: This study suggests that the K-HIV-SE is useful for efficiently assessing self-efficacy for HIV disease management.

  • The purpose of this study is to find methods for logo renewal design according to the brand life cycle, considering the logo as an important visual tool that represents the brand identity in terms of brand management. This study was conducted through literature study on brand life cycle and brand renewal strategy, an expert survey on logo renewal design, and logo analysis of 35 food and beverage brands with statistical data to determine brand life cycle. The results of the study are three. First, the four stages(introduction, growth, maturity, and decline) of brand life cycle characteristics and renewal strategies were derived. Second, four brand renewal strategies(partial change, total change, repositioning, new image creation) and methods for logo renewal design were proposed based on the life cycle of the brand. Based on this, renewal characteristics for each life cycle were proposed. Third, visual elements of identity that are important depending on the brand life cycle and brand renewal strategy were found. It was found that the addition and subtraction of graphic elements and change of color tone are important in the partial change strategy of the growth period and maturity period, and that the change of signature color is important in the repositioning strategy and the creation of the new image.

  • The term ecosystem services refers to natural ecosystems' benefits to humans. Various models have been developed and applied to quantify ecosystem services. Habitat quality assessment is a widely used leading InVEST ecosystem service model. In Korea, habitat quality assessment is conducted for national parks. For habitat quality assessment, the initial value of habitat quality must be used to assess the sensitivity to threats, which varies depending on the country and application field. Therefore, an expert survey (AHP) was conducted based on previous habitat quality assessments in national parks to adjust the sensitivity, the initial value for the habit quality assessment. As a result of the AHP, 18 items were adjusted, including 10 items, such as natural grassland and unarranged fields, upward and 8 items, such as rivers and ponds, downward. Based on the adjusted sensitivity results, the habitat quality of Bukhansan National Park and Gyeryongsan National Park (urban type), Gyeongju National Park (historic type), Hallyeohaesang National Park (ocean type), and Jirisan National Park and Seoraksan National Park (mountain type) were adjusted. The results of the analysis showed that the habitat quality of urban dry areas and water bodies distributed in the national parks was reflected in the habitat quality assessment. In the future, it will be possible to evaluate the habitat quality of natural parks using this standard.

  • With the active utilization of Online Judge (OJ) systems in the field of education, various studies utilizing learner data have emerged. This research proposes a problem recommendation based on a user-based collaborative filtering approach with learner data to support learners in their problem selection. Assistance in learners' problem selection within the OJ system is crucial for enhancing the effectiveness of education as it impacts the learning path. To achieve this, this system identifies learners with similar problem-solving tendencies and utilizes their problem-solving history. The proposed technique has been implemented on an OJ site in the fields of algorithms and programming, operated by the Chungbuk Education Research and Information Institute. The technique's service utility and usability were assessed through expert reviews using the Delphi technique. Additionally, it was piloted with site users, and an analysis of the ratio of correctness revealed approximately a 16% higher submission rate for recommended problems compared to the overall submissions. A survey targeting users who used the recommended problems yielded a 78% response rate, with the majority indicating that the feature was helpful. However, low selection rates of recommended problems and low response rates within the subset of users who used recommended problems highlight the need for future research focusing on improving accessibility, enhancing user feedback collection, and diversifying learner data analysis.

  • Purpose To survey perceptions of certified physicians on the protocol of chest CT in patients with coronavirus (COVID-19) using a negative pressure isolation stretcher (NPIS). Materials and Methods This study collected questionnaire responses from a total of 27 certified physicians who had previously performed chest CT with NPIS in COVID-19 isolation hospitals. Results The nine surveyed hospitals performed an average of 116 chest CT examinations with NPIS each year. Of these, an average of 24 cases (21%) were contrast chest CT. Of the 9 pulmonologists we surveyed, 5 (56%) agreed that patients who showed abnormalities in serum D-dimer required contrast chest CT. All 9 surveyed radiologists agreed that the image quality of the chest CT with NPIS was sufficient for CT image interpretation regarding pneumonia or pulmonary embolism. Furthermore, in our 9 surveyed infectionologists, 5 (56%) agreed that a risk of secondary infection in the CT room after temporary opening of NPIS could be prevented through a process of disinfection. Conclusion Experienced physicians considered that the effects of NIPS on chest CT image quality was minimal in patients with COVID-19, and the risk of CT room contamination was easily controlled.

  • Understanding the status of surface cover in riparian zones is essential for river management and flood disaster prevention. Traditional survey methods rely on expert interpretation of vegetation through vegetation mapping or indices. However, these methods are limited by their ability to accurately reflect dynamically changing river environments. Against this backdrop, this study utilized satellite imagery to apply the Random Forest method to assess the distribution of vegetation in rivers over multiple years, focusing on the Naeseong Stream as a case study. Remote sensing data from Sentinel-2 imagery were combined with ground truth data from the Naeseong Stream surface cover in 2016. The Random Forest machine learning algorithm was used to extract and train 1,000 samples per surface cover from ten predetermined sampling areas, followed by validation. A sensitivity analysis, annual surface cover analysis, and accuracy assessment were conducted to evaluate their applicability. The results showed an accuracy of 85.1% based on the validation data. Sensitivity analysis indicated the highest efficiency in 30 trees, 800 samples, and the downstream river section. Surface cover analysis accurately reflects the actual river environment. The accuracy analysis identified 14.9% boundary and internal errors, with high accuracy observed in six categories, excluding scattered and herbaceous vegetation. Although this study focused on a single river, applying the surface cover classification method to multiple rivers is necessary to obtain more accurate and comprehensive data.

  • Purpose: The current study was conducted in order to develop the Korean Healthy Eating Index (KHEI) for assessing adherence to national dietary guidelines and comprehensive diet quality of healthy Korean adults using the 5th Korea National Health and Nutrition Examination Survey (KNHANES) data. Methods: The candidate components of KHEI were selected based on literature reviews, dietary guidelines for Korean adults, 2010 Dietary Reference Intakes for Koreans (2010 KDRI), and objectives of HP 2020. The associations between candidate components and risk of obesity, abdominal obesity, and metabolic syndrome were assessed using the 5th KNHANES data. The expert review process was also performed. Results: Diets that meet the food group recommendations per each energy level receive maximum scores for the 9 adequacy components of the index. Scores for amounts between zero and the standard are prorated linearly. For the three moderation components among the total of five, population probability densities were examined when setting the standards for minimum and maximum scores. Maximum scores for the total of 14 components are 100 points and each component has maximum scores of 5 (fruit intakes excluding juice, fruit intake including juice, vegetable intakes excluding Kimchi and pickles, vegetable intake including Kimchi or pickles, ratio of white meat to read meat, whole grains intake, refined grains intake, and percentages of energy intake from carbohydrate) or 10 points (protein foods intake, milk and dairy food intake, having breakfast, sodium intake, percentages of energy intake from empty calorie foods, and percentages of energy intake from fat). The KHEI is a measure of diet quality as specified by the key diet recommendations of the dietary guidelines and 2010 KDRIs. Conclusion: The KHEI will be used as a tool for monitoring diet quality of the Korean population and subpopulations, evaluation of nutrition interventions and research.
